I'm employed in the arts and literature field. My work gives me plenty of free time to pursue other interests. As I did not have a good understanding of the Fa and the responsibilities that practitioners shoulder, I didn't meet the requirements set forth for practitioners and often did not go to work, thinking that nothing in the human world is as important as my cultivation. I remained in the state of personal cultivation and feared pollution by ordinary society. I didn't participate in symposiums offered by the art and literature circles. I was perfunctory in my work and reluctant in taking part in various art exhibitions by offering a few pieces of my artwork, thinking that I had completely let go of my attachments to fame and personal gain. I became estranged from family and friends, as I frequently turned down invitations from family, friends and co-workers; I saw those events as a waste of time. I used to be well known and respected professionally by many different people. Later, one of my peers asked me in a puzzled tone: “You don't pursue anything anymore and no longer desire professional advancement. What happened to you?” This remark didn't wake me up and I didn't realize that my cultivation state had a negative influence on how people would think of the Fa. I kept doing things based on my human notions and my incorrect understanding of cultivation, and thereby did not grasp the cultivation opportunities arranged for me by Teacher.

Teacher said:

"Many students understand only that doing the exercises and studying the Fa are cultivation. Yes, with those you directly engage the Fa. But as you go about truly cultivating yourself in your day-to-day life, the society that you come into contact with is your cultivation environment. The work and family environments that you spend time in are both settings in which you are to cultivate yourselves, are part of the path you must walk, are what you must handle, and handle correctly at that. None of these should be glossed over. When you have made it to the end, [a question would be]: How did you travel the path that Master arranged for you? When all is said and done, these things have to be taken into account. And in the course of your cultivation these things have to be looked at, too. So you shouldn't neglect anything. As far as convenience goes, [in Dafa] a person can cultivate without having to enter a monastery, go to a secluded mountain, or leave the secular world. But from another perspective, all of this adds a layer of difficulty: If you are to make it through, you have to do well with things such as all of the above, and do well in every aspect of your life." ("Teaching the Fa in Canada, 2006")
